Laura Polloni is a scholar working on Immunology and Allergy, Clinical Psychology and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Laura Polloni has authored 20 papers receiving a total of 375 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Immunology and Allergy, 8 papers in Clinical Psychology and 5 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Laura Polloni's work include Food Allergy and Anaphylaxis Research (15 papers), Allergic Rhinitis and Sensitization (6 papers) and Eosinophilic Esophagitis (5 papers). Laura Polloni is often cited by papers focused on Food Allergy and Anaphylaxis Research (15 papers), Allergic Rhinitis and Sensitization (6 papers) and Eosinophilic Esophagitis (5 papers). Laura Polloni collaborates with scholars based in Italy, Ireland and United Kingdom. Laura Polloni's co-authors include Antonella Muraro, Francesca Lazzarotto, Roberta Bonaguro, Darío Gregori, Ileana Baldi, Emilia Ferruzza, Alice Toniolo, Francesca Foltran, Ana Paula Muraro and Lucia Ronconi and has published in prestigious journals such as Allergy, Clinical & Experimental Allergy and Journal of Health Psychology.
